PinchukArtCentre and British Council Ukraine presented Open Study Programme

01.10.2012

The joint educational programme of these two institutions provided Ukrainian public with deeper understanding of Anish Kapoor’s art. A series of three public talks and a screening of the documentary The year of Anish Kapoor were presented as part of the project

Exhibition “Shoah by Bullets: Mass shootings of Jews in Ukraine 1941–1944” officially opened in Dnipropetrovsk on September 28

28.09.2012

The exhibition is on display in the hall of the diorama Battle for the Dnieper River at the Yavornytskyi National Museum of History (Dnipropetrovsk, 16 Karl Marx Ave.) from September 29 through October 17, 2012
